Environmental Achievements
- Implemented an Environmental and Industrial Management System
- Invested US$3.02 million in environmental management program in 2010 (more than three times the 2009 investment)
- Reduced waste through installation of waste incineration units at Varvara
- Implemented state-of-the-art ‘POX’ system for gold extraction at Albazino-Amursk, reducing waste and operating costs and recovering heat energy

Environmental Achievements
- Updated our Environmental Management System in compliance with updated version of ISO 14001:2015
- Developed our Climate Strategy 2020 and carbon management programmes
- Implemented Energy Management System designed in compliance with ISO
- Developed Mine Closure Standard and Tailing Management System with implementation in 2018
- Reduced energy used in ore processing by 0.4%
- Recycled 22% of total waste generated

- Reuse at least 20% of annual volumes of overburden/waste rock by 2020
- Continuously reduce water consumption and water discharge by effectively using water resources by 2020
- Reduce direct impacts on biodiversity by 2020
- Develop and implement our Climate Management System with respect to greenhouse gas (GHG), climate risk and carbon footprint management by 2020
- Decrease GHG emissions by at least 1% by 2020
- Decrease sulphur dioxide emissions by at least 1% by 2020

Environmental Achievements
- Reduced GHG emissions intensity by 7%
- 83% of water recycled
- 27% of waste reused (excluding Kyzyl)
- Implemented dry stack tailings management system at Amursk POX, reducing risk of dam failure
- Launched pilot solar and wind energy projects

Environmental Achievements
- Reduced freshwater use for processing by 53% Group-wide compared to 2019 baseline; 47% reduction in Kazakhstan.
- 93% of water reused/recycled Group-wide and 90% in Kazakhstan.
- 15% decrease in GHG emissions intensity Group-wide compared with 2019.
Social Achievements
- Zero fatalities Group-wide and zero fatalities in Kazakhstan.
- Group-wide LTIFR of 0.07 (2022: 0.10); LTIFR in Kazakhstan 0.
- Voluntary turnover rate below 10% (4.7% Group-wide and 1.4% in Kazakhstan).
- $17.6m invested in social projects Group-wide and $7.3m in Kazakhstan.

Climate Goals & Targets
- Develop a long-term Climate Strategy, including an approach to achieving carbon neutrality.
- Reduce GHG emission intensity per ounce of gold equivalent by 30% by 2030 (Scopes 1 and 2, 2019 baseline).
- Reduce absolute GHG emissions by 35% by 2030 (Scopes 1 and 2, 2019 baseline).
- Achieve 7% of total electricity self-generation from renewable sources by 2025.
- Maintain LTIFR at zero level in Kazakhstan.
- Maintain fresh water consumption intensity per tonne of ore processed in Kazakhstan at the achieved minimal level.
- Maintain the share of water recycled/reused Kyzyl and Varvara hub at the 2023 level.
